Note: Make sure that the polarity of the batteries is correct. The positive (+) and negative (-)
ends of each battery must match the positive (+) and negative (-) markings in the battery
housing.
Note: The receiver can be removed and stored next to the battery compartment while not in use.
DPI Switch
The mouse supports 6 levels DPI800/1200/1600/2400/3200/4800. To switch to either setting,
press the "DPI +" button on the top of the mouse once to upgrade the DPI, LED light would flash
for appropriate times, when DPI reaches 4800, press "DPI +" button, LED would not flash. Click
the "DPI -" button on the top of the mouse once to downgrade the DPI, LED light would flash for
appropriate times. When DPI reaches 800, press DPI- button, LED would not flash
Receiver Connection
Remove the USB Nano receiver and plug it into a free USB port in your computer. Turn on the
mouse. The Plug & Play function of your system will detect a new device has been connected
and install it automatically.
